Responsibilities The house supervisor provides administrative and nursing leadership for staff involved in the provision of patient care services. The house supervisor provides administrative decision making and assists with coordination of patient flow, patient placement, staff allocation, and other patient services through collaboration with administrative/supervisory staff, physicians, charge nurses and ancillary support staff across all hospital departments. As the onsite administrative/nursing leadership representative, the house supervisor provides direction and guidance for hospital staff in interpretation/application of policies and procedures, problem solving, utilization and assignment of nursing resources, response to patient/family complaints/concerns and initiation of emergency preparedness plans for any presenting emergency situations. Responsibilities The licensed practical nurse (LPN) provides nursing care to assigned patients under the direct supervision of the registered nurse (RN) or other assigned supervisor and accepts delegation from the RN/assigned supervisor in meeting the needs of the patient/family. The LPN collects data through observation and communicates information to assist the RN and/or provider in patient assessment and care planning. The LPN participates as a member of the health care team and accepts delegation from the RN/assigned supervisor and provider in meeting needs of the patient/family. The LPN delivers care in accordance with the patient care plan, policies and procedures of the organization and principles of relationship-based care. The LPN possesses excellent communication skills; is skillful in mentoring and instructing; and may participate on committees or projects, including quality improvement projects. Qualifications Graduate of a school of practical nursing or passed LPN Boards after a defined period in a professional nursing program (e.g., some states allow RN students to take the LPN board exam after completing one to two years in the RN program). Responsibilities The medical assistant performs assigned tasks of direct and indirect care in the ambulatory setting to meet the care needs of patients under the direct supervision of a physician (medical acts) or assigned supervisor. The medical assistant participates as a member of the health care team and accepts appropriate delegation from the RN or physician in meeting needs of the patient/family. The medical assistant performs assigned tasks in accordance with the patient care plan, policies and procedures of the organization and principles of relationship-based care. The medical assistant carries out designated activities that are within those functions limited by law to unlicensed health care personnel. Qualifications High school diploma or GED equivalent.
